National Level On-line Quiz Competition on “UNESCO World Heritage sites of India”

 Post Graduate department of History of Khalsa College for Women, Civil lines celebrated International World Heritage Day by organizing a national level e-quiz on Indian Heritage sites under UNESCO.

                     In 1982, UNESCO’s  General Conference established 18th April as the International day for Monuments and sites. The theme for 2021 is “ Complex Pasts: Diverse Futures”. This day is celebrated to spread awareness of our rich cultural diversity and the importance of preserving our ancient heritage.

                               India has now 38 World Heritage sites and that makes India with the 6th largest number of World Heritage sites in the world. There are 30 cultural sites, 7 natural sites and 1 mixed as recognized by UNESCO.

                                   Students from all over India participated in the quiz. Students scoring 70% and above in the quiz were given e-certificates.
